I figured I should share what I know about the Fall 2015 application so far.

So far this is what I know:

  1. Spring 2015 students do not need an entrance exam - let's see if they keep it this way for Fall 2015 applicants
  2. There will be a mandatory SOS Pre Nursing Bootcamp that will need to be attended upon acceptance to the program.
  3. I called advising today (7/7/14) the receptionist said I should start applying in January, but I'll confirm that once again before then.
  4. 60% sciences and 40% cumulative GPA is still the criteria as far as we know.

Please can you share your experience with the Hesi. My only hope is to score in the 90s to have a better chance. Is it that difficult ?

It wasn't as difficult as I thought it was going to be. BUT the A&p questions were mind boggling I was so scared I failed that portion but I ended up with a 98 for that section and a total of an 86. Study lots of fractions improper and mixed, you're going to have a very little calculator on each question that you may use. Study quarts and cups I suggest googling the "big g method for quarts and cups" and clicking on the first link best way to remember.

Reading and grammar if English is your first language you should be okay. But still study some reading comprehension exercises especially main idea some of the questions can be just a tad tricky there. If you have a smartphone download the HESI practice apps so you can study all the time.
